    I have a friend who just moved here from Australia. He really dislikes Dole pineapple juice (called Annanas juice in Australia) from the dairy case and the canned tastes like tin.

    We found some Hawaiian pineaple juice at Trader Joe's but it is not sweet so its not good for drinks unless you add sugar or another sweetner.

    Does anyone know of a good source for fresh/frozen pineapple juice that is sweet enough to drink without adding a sweetner? and isn't from concentrate.

    I recently picked up some Zain juices at Pete's. They were on 'special' at $1.50. The mango and guava were good - and as I remembered. I did pick up a pineapple juice as well. The label says 100% juice and not from concentrate, though it does have added vitamin C.
    The expiry date on it was Aug. 05. Visually, the juice wasn't pineapply yellow, but rather a dirty yellow. It did taste like it may have been fresh pineapple juice that had been sitting out for a while. Not soured and funky, just sort of muted and oxidized. It did taste better than it looked though and we finished the packet, but I didn't waste any Malibu on it. I'm not sure if this is how the Zain pineapple juice is normally, I doubt it; I'll look for something further away from expiration next time.
